Output e6636c00cf5b51b632a3d1349e1c7f8a8dd7da5d8073e1b62367103f0df8ffdf:1

value
613259
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5947bf129bb08876a9a2f775fe8858fb89bb3a56 OP_EQUAL
address
39q61eDCyqTUd2K9tmAHTAb8gr58QevHk7
transaction
e6636c00cf5b51b632a3d1349e1c7f8a8dd7da5d8073e1b62367103f0df8ffdf
confirmations
163893
spent
true